Evaluation report of the regional dialogue on energy efficiency and renewable energy policy in The Caribbean

2016-07-18

LC/CAR/L.499

This document presents the evaluation report of the “Regional dialogue on energy efficiency and renewable energy policy” meeting, aimed at presenting one of the key targeted outputs of the GIZ/ECLAC project titled: “Sustainable energy in the Caribbean: Reducing the carbon footprint in the Caribbean through the promotion of energy efficiency and the use of renewable energy technologies.” The objective of the meeting was to foster dialogue and to share experiences among Caribbean countries on issues related to energy efficiency and renewable energy policy, with a view towards crafting better strategies for enhancing the subregion’s energy security in the face of the challenge of global climate change.
